Based in the industrial manufacturing hub of Guangzhou, we leverage direct access to primary steel producers. Our strategic raw material sourcing guarantees trace-certified structural steel grades (such as Q355B and Q235B, comparable to ASTM A572 and S355JR) at optimal price performance.
By utilizing localized CAD/CAM processes and CNC-driven bending, plasma cutting, and high-precision welding, we convert designs into structural elements with minimal lead times. We facilitate early-stage design validations through BIM coordination to eliminate on-site discrepancies.
All custom structural systems are manufactured under stringent quality protocols. Non-destructive testing (NDT), ultrasonic inspections of critical welds, and precision measurement trials are conducted internally before global shipping, mitigating erection issues at the installation site.

Through deep modeling calculations, we design pre-engineered structures that withstand environmental forces. By using professional finite element modeling software such as Tekla Structures and SAP2000, we optimize the weight-to-strength ratio of our H-sections and truss configurations. This methodology directly saves client investment by minimizing unnecessary steel tonnage while ensuring the structures easily manage snow loads, heavy crane operations, and localized seismic activity.

Modern distribution facilities require wide clear-span designs to host high-speed sorting systems. We develop buildings with unobstructed floor plans exceeding 60 meters in span width. Additionally, we integrate self-supporting clad-rack systems compatible with modern four-way shuttle designs.
Heavy manufacturing relies on integrated gantry cranes and production lines. Our workshops are designed to support overhead crane brackets ranging from 5 to 50 tons. These designs incorporate high-tensile H-shape columns and vibration-resistant crane runway girders.

The global construction landscape is pivoting rapidly toward decarbonization and carbon-neutral building design. Steel, being 100% recyclable, has emerged as the premier structural medium for LEED-certified projects. At Guangzhou Dhingia Build Co., Ltd., we prioritize high-tensile steel formulations that yield the same loading capacity with less physical mass, effectively reducing the embedded carbon footprint of our prefabricated building packages.
To combat aggressive offshore and chemical environments, Dhingia Build utilizes advanced anti-corrosion schemes. By employing zinc-rich epoxy primers combined with polyurethane topcoats, our structures resist corrosion for over 25 years before requiring structural maintenance. Additionally, hot-dip galvanization (conforming to ISO 1461 standards) provides a robust barrier against environmental moisture.
Design for Manufacture and Assembly (DFMA) represents a major shift in modern construction. By completing the primary processes—cutting, drilling, welding, and painting—under controlled factory conditions, we eliminate wet processes on the jobsite. This approach ensures that erection schedules are accelerated by up to 40% compared to traditional on-site fabrication methods.
